Scope of Work
This requirement is for the manufacture and design of TAPE,GUMMED, specifically Part Number 173870 (with acceptable alternate IMANPY SPEC 9.4.11.2), manufactured by VELCRO USA INC (CAGE 11153).
- Marking: Must comply with MIL-STD-129, including manufacturer's FSCM/CAGE and item part number on intermediate and unit packs, plus special marking for shelf-life items (cure/expiration dates).
- Shelf-Life: Items must have at least 85% of their 48-month shelf-life remaining at shipment.
- Mercury Exclusion: No mercury or mercury-containing compounds are to be intentionally added or come into direct contact with hardware/supplies.
